ysqlysql1ysql亂碼問題的方法。
回答:ysql字符集
ysqlyiyfysqlysqld]下添加以下代碼:
ysqld]
character-set-server=utf8
ysqlysql字符集修改為utf8,解決中文亂碼問題。
ysql表字符集
ysql已經創建了表,且表中存在中文數據,可以通過修改表字符集的方式解決中文亂碼問題。具體步驟如下:
(1)查看表的字符集
可以通過以下命令查看表的字符集:
SHOW CREATE TABLE 表名;
(2)修改表字符集
如果表字符集不是utf8或gbk,可以通過以下語句修改表字符集:
ALTER TABLE 表名 CONVERT TO CHARACTER SET utf8;
ALTER TABLE 表名 CONVERT TO CHARACTER SET gbk;
ysql連接字符集
ysqlysql時,可以添加以下代碼:
ysqlicodecoding=utf8
icodeicodecoding=utf8表示使用utf8字符集。
ysql亂碼問題的三種方法,可以根據具體情況選擇相應的方法進行解決。